MICROCAPITAL BRIEF: IDB Loans $40m to Panama to Support Entrepreneurship, Financial Inclusion Among Indigenous Peoples

The Inter-American Development Bank (IDB), a US-based development finance institution, recently approved a 24-year loan of USD 40 million to the nation of Panama. The loan, co-funded with USD 3 million from the government of Panama, is to be used for projects addressing the needs of for-profit businesses and other organizations run by indigenous people, including those that improve access to financial services and infrastructure. MICROCAPITAL BRIEF: Bandhan Sells $474m in Microloans to HDFC Bank, IDBI Bank, Yes Bank

Bandhan Bank, an Indian microfinance institution that is organized as a commercial bank, recently sold INR 32 billion (USD 474 million) of “priority sector loans to more experienced private sector rivals to help them meet lending targets.” Indian regulators require banks to invest certain percentages of their holdings in “priority sectors” such as agriculture. Chandra Shekhar, the Managing Director of Bandhan Bank, said that Bandhan Bank had used “inter-bank participation certificates” to sell the loans to India’s HDFC Bank, IDBI Bank and Yes Bank.

MICROCAPITAL BRIEF: IDB Approves $120m Loan for Chile for Factoring, Cooperatives, Leasing for MSMEs

The Inter-American Development Bank (IDB), a US-based multilateral finance institution that operates in Latin America and the Caribbean, recently approved a loan of USD 120 million to the Chilean government to finance the development of micro-, small, and medium-sized enterprises (MSMEs). The loan is divided into three parts: (1) USD 50 million for factoring to “fund eligible entities that neither belong to nor are associated with banks”; (2) USD 50 million to lend to “eligible Savings and Lending Cooperatives”; and (3) USD 20 million for “eligible leasing companies that neither belong to nor are associated with a bank to help them finance MSMEs…” Factoring is a process whereby a company sells future goods or services at a discount in return for immediate cash.
